Ingredients You’ll Need

The beauty of making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os lies in the simplicity and accessibility of the ingredients. Each one plays a crucial role in crafting the perfect balance of creamy, fluffy, and crispy textures.

  • Large Eggs: The star of the show, providing protein and a fluffy base for the filling.
  • Shredded Cheese: Choose cheddar, Monterey Jack, or a blend for that signature melty pull.
  • Flour or Corn Tortillas: Soft and warm, they hold everything together and add subtle texture.
  • Butter or Oil: Used to cook the eggs to a silky, non-stick finish with a touch of flavor.
  • Salt and Pepper: Basic seasonings that enhance the natural flavor of the eggs and cheese.
  • Optional Extras: Fresh cilantro, diced tomatoes, or hot sauce to brighten or spice up the dish.

Variations for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os

One of the best things about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os is how easy they are to customize. Whether you want to keep it classic or experiment with new flavors, adapting this recipe is no fuss.

  • Veggie Delight: Add sautéed bell peppers, onions, or spinach for an extra nutritional punch.
  • Spicy Kick: Mix in jalapeños or sprinkle cayenne pepper to turn up the heat.
  • Meaty Upgrade: Toss in cooked bacon, sausage, or chorizo for a heartier bite.
  • Dairy-Free Version: Swap cheese with vegan cheese or avocado slices for creaminess without dairy.
  • Southwest Style: Top with black beans, salsa, and a squeeze of lime for a zesty twist.

How to Make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os

Step 1: Prepare Your Ingredients

Gather all your ingredients and shred the cheese if it’s not pre-shredded. Warm the tortillas briefly in a pan or microwave to make them pliable and easy to fold later.

Step 2: Whisk the Eggs

Crack the eggs into a bowl, add a pinch of salt and pepper, and whisk until fully blended and slightly frothy to ensure fluffy eggs.

Step 3: Cook the Eggs

Heat butter or oil in a non-stick skillet over medium heat. Pour in the eggs and gently stir with a spatula, cooking until they just start to set but remain soft and creamy.

Step 4: Add the Cheese

Sprinkle shredded cheese directly over the eggs in the pan, allowing it to melt and combine fully with the eggs for that rich, gooey texture.

Step 5: Assemble the Tacos

Spoon the cheesy eggs onto your warm tortillas. Add any optional toppings like salsa or cilantro, then fold and serve immediately for the best taste and texture.

Pro Tips for Making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os

  • Low and Slow Cooking: Cook eggs on medium-low heat for creamy, tender curds instead of dry scramble.
  • Use Fresh Cheese: Freshly shredded cheese melts more evenly and quickly than pre-packaged shredded varieties.
  • Warm the Tortillas: Softening tortillas prevents cracking and makes wrapping much easier.
  • Don’t Overcook Eggs: Remove from heat when eggs look slightly underdone, as they’ll finish cooking from residual heat.
  • Customize Sauces: Add your favorite hot sauce or salsa for an extra layer of flavor without extra effort.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

Place leftover cheesy eggs and tortillas separately in airtight containers in the fridge for up to two days to keep flavors fresh and textures intact.

Freezing

It’s best not to freeze assembled tacos, but you can freeze scrambled eggs and cheese mixture in portions and reheat quickly when ready to serve.

Reheating

Rewarm the eggs gently in a skillet or microwave with a splash of water to revive moisture, then warm the tortillas separately before assembling.

FAQs

Can I use egg substitutes for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os?

Absolutely! Plant-based egg alternatives or egg whites can be used and will work well with the cheese for a different but equally tasty taco experience.

What types of cheese work best in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os?

Cheddar, Monterey Jack, Pepper Jack, or even a mild mozzarella are great choices because they melt smoothly and enhance the eggs’ flavor.

Can I make Cheesy Breakfast Egg Tacos vegan?

Yes, by using vegan cheese and plant-based scrambled eggs made from tofu or chickpea flour, you can create a delicious vegan version of this classic breakfast.

How can I keep my tortillas from getting soggy?

Warm and lightly toast the tortillas before assembling your tacos to create a barrier against moisture and keep them firm longer.

Are these tacos suitable for meal prep?

Definitely! Prepare the egg and cheese filling in advance and store separately; then quickly assemble and reheat when needed for a fast and satisfying meal.
